What is industrial democracy in industrial relations?

Industrial democracy is an arrangement which involves workers making decisions, sharing responsibility and authority in the workplace.

What are the objectives of industrial democracy?

The objectives of industrial democracy are: (i) The create a sense of belongingness of workers to the organisation. (ii) To improve a sense of commitment to the organisational objectives, plans and activities among employers. (iii) To satisfy the psychological needs of the employees.

    What are examples of industrial actions?

    Forms of industrial action

    • strike – where workers refuse to work for the employer.
    • action short of a strike – where workers take action such as working to rule, go slows, overtime bans or callout bans.
    • lock-out – a work stoppage where the employer stops workers from working.

      Can you be sacked for industrial action?

      You can claim unfair dismissal at an employment tribunal if you’re dismissed for taking industrial action at any time within the 12 weeks after the action began. After 12 weeks, you can be dismissed if you take industrial action and your employer has tried to settle the dispute.

      What is industrial harmony?

      Industrial harmony refers to a friendly and cooperative agreement on working relationships between employers and employees for their mutual benefit (Laden, 2012). In effect, it is a situation where employees and management cooperate willingly in pursuit of the organization’s aims and objectives.
